#258896 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#258896 is composed of 14.5% red, 53.3%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.3% cyan, 9.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 187.4 degrees, a saturation of 60.4% and a lightness of 36.7%. #258896 color hex could be obtained by blending #4affff with #00112d.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#258896 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#258896 has RGB values of R:37, G:136,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 2459798.
